HOW TO REGISTER A PARTNERSHIP BUSINESS IN SECURITIES AND EXCHANGE

COMMISSION?

1. Create an Account on the SEC Company Registration System(CRS)

 www.crs.sec.gov.ph

 Sign up (Fill up all the needed information)

 Verify you Account through your e-mail address

2. Verify your Company Name

 www.crs.sec.gov.ph

 Login your Account

 Register New Company Name and fill up all the needed information and

follow the steps

 Note: A validated name is still subject for further evaluation by the

processors of the SEC


3. Read your restrictions and required documents to be submitted

 Cover Sheet

 Articles of Partnership

 Treasurer’s Affidavit

 By Laws

 Note: These documents will be generated by the system once you complete

all the forms.

*YOU HAVE 30 DAYS TO COMPLETE THE REGISTRATION

4. Continue to fill up your Company Details

 Upload your required documents

 Required documents may vary depending on your nature/type of business.

REGISTERING CORPORATION ONLINE


The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) rolled out its online Company Registration

System (CRS) in November 2017 in an effort to streamline the registration of businesses

operating in the Philippines.

STEP 1: Create your account

 Using your internet browser, go to sec.gov.ph.

 On the right-hand side of the page, you’ll see the email and password fields for

logging in. Below the green “Login” button, click Sign Up.

 Enter your basic information, including your Tax Identification Number. Make

sure that all fields marked with an asterisk (*) are filled in. Here, you will also be

asked to provide a valid email address and create a password that you will use to

access your SEC account.

 The CRS will send an email validation message with the subject, “Account

Activation.” Click Verify Address to complete this step.

STEP 2: Verify your company name

 On sec.gov.ph, log in using the email address and password you registered

with when you created your account.

 On your account dashboard, click the menu button found at the top left

corner of the page, then select Register New Company. Be sure to read the

Terms and Conditions carefully before proceeding.


NOTE: All of your input from this point forward will affect all subsequent steps and

requirements for your company registration. Be sure that the options selected at this stage

are final.

 The “Verify Company” page will load, requesting the following

information:

o Company type (stock, non-stock, foreign, etc.)

o Company classification

o Major industry classification and subclass

The required fields for these sections feature drop-down lists so you have default options

to choose from.

 Under the “Verify Name” section, type your proposed company name

and choose a suffix, such as Corporation, Corp., Incorporated, or Inc.

Responses for this section are case-sensitive, including the suffix, so

be mindful of your capitalization.

Refrain from including symbols such as &, #, !, @, $, %, *, (, and ) in your company name.

These characters may cause problems in the CRS filing system.

 Click Validate to check whether your proposed name is still available.

Note that even if no duplicates are found, a validated name is still

subject to evaluation by the SEC.


 After validation, select the SEC office where you intend to submit your

requirements and process your company registration.

 Click Next and review your company information on the “Confirm

Verification Summary” page. If you wish to modify any information,

click Edit at the top right corner of the section to enable revision.

 Click Save and Exit. A transaction number will be created for your

application. This will appear on your dashboard every time you log in.

At this point, the CRS will give you four (4) days to complete your

registration.

STEP 3: Add your company details

 On your account dashboard, click the transaction number to add your

Company Information. Indicate whether your company is based in an

Economic Zone and add a Principal Office Address. These details will

be included in your Articles of Incorporation or Partnership and By-

Laws.

 Click Save and Exit or Next to proceed to the “Registration Guidelines”

page. Your registration restrictions and required documents will be

listed in detail here.

 Proceed to the “Add Company Details” page. From here, provide the

following information as they apply to your business:

o Company classification

o Purpose clause

o Term of existence
o Capital structure

o Number of corporators, along with their individual profiles

o Corporate subscribers, if any

o Foreign equity detail, if applicable

o Contact information

o Nature of business activity

o By-Laws information

STEP 4: Upload required documents

 Based on your responses to the above fields, the CRS will generate the

following documentary requirements:

 Cover Sheet

 Articles of Incorporation

 Treasurer’s Affidavit

 By-laws

 Upload your official receipt or proof of payment, along

with signed and notarized copies of your Articles of

Incorporation/Partnership, By-laws, and other documentary

requirements. Wait for the next email notification.


STEP 5: Submit your original documents to SEC and claim your certificate of

registration

When you receive an email advising you to submit your signed and notarized documentary

requirements, you’re done with the online steps. Go to the SEC’s Company Registration and

Monitoring Department, located at the ground floor of the Secretariat Bldg., PICC Complex,

Pasay City.

If your documents are complete and in order, you can claim your Certificate of

Incorporation on the same day. Congratulations! Your company is registered with the SEC.

You will also receive the company’s Unified Registration Records (URR) bearing the

Employer’s Registration Numbers issued by the Social Security System, Home Development

Mutual Fund, and PhilHealth. You will also get the company’s Tax Identification Number

issued by the Bureau of Internal Revenue.
